let me just say if we were to rephrase this, I would say the first paragraph we are talking about ``among the federally created programs'' would have language that is more clear. If my colleague from California wants to vote against the report for that reason, that is fine but just vote for the constitutional amendment. Let me respond to my friend from Nevada, because the paragraph that he quotes is correct. The REA serves people in Nevada, California, Idaho, and Illinois. We do permit Government-backed bonds. Now, when we put out those REA bonds we put a little bit into the Treasury. Whatever CBO determines is a risk factor, that is put there. Now, when my colleague from California says, well, if Bonneville went down the tube, we probably would rescue then, I think that is correct. I would just remind the Senator that we also rescued Lockheed. We also rescued Chrysler. We will not put any more in here from Michigan for Chrysler or Ford or General Motors, but we do put whatever risk factor we have to when there are federally backed bonds.
